GibbsFactor Posted November 12, 2010 Share Posted November 12, 2010 In a fight? The Man of Steel, without question.Which one is a better hero? Batman. See, I completely disagree and realize I'm in the minority. Sure he's hard to relate to but think about it for a second. Dude has all the power in the world and could be a complete ruler of the universe but chooses not to? So what if he can fly and can shoot fire from his eyes and is an alien. The point of the hero called Superman is that he has God like powers but doesn't abuse them. He's the most ethical and moral person in the Universe with God-like powers. Hands down the greatest hero ever conceived and everyone should aspire to be like him. He doesn't help people for some complex or required reason. He helps simply because he can.
